How has been the historical performance of Kaizen Agro?

12-Nov-2025

Kaizen Agro has experienced a significant decline in financial performance from March 2015 to March 2017, with net sales dropping from 104 crore to 21.92 crore, and profits decreasing across all metrics, including a negative cash flow of 9.67 crore in March 2017. Total liabilities and assets also fell during this period.

Answer:<BR>The historical performance of Kaizen Agro shows a significant decline in key financial metrics over the years.<BR><BR>Breakdown:<BR>Kaizen Agro's net sales have decreased from 104.00 crore in March 2015 to 26.87 crore in March 2016, and further down to 21.92 crore in March 2017. The total operating income followed a similar trend, dropping from 104.00 crore in March 2015 to 21.92 crore in March 2017. Operating profit (PBDIT) also saw a decline, falling from 0.96 crore in March 2015 to just 0.06 crore in March 2017. Profit before tax decreased from 0.88 crore in March 2015 to 0.04 crore in March 2017, and profit after tax similarly fell from 0.61 crore to 0.03 crore over the same period. The earnings per share (EPS) dropped from 0.29 in March 2015 to 0.01 in March 2017. On the balance sheet, total liabilities decreased from 84.84 crore in March 2015 to 70.71 crore in March 2017, while total assets also declined from 84.84 crore to 70.71 crore. Cash flow from operating activities turned negative, with a cash outflow of 9.67 crore in March 2017 compared to a positive inflow of 35.53 crore in March 2016. Overall, Kaizen Agro's financial performance has shown a downward trend across multiple dimensions over the past three years.

About Kaizen Agro Infrabuild Ltd stock-summary
stock-summary
Kaizen Agro Infrabuild Ltd
Micro Cap
Construction
Kaizen Agro Infrabuild Limited was incorporated in January 20, 2006 as "Anubhav Vanijya Private Limited" to deal in as wholesaler / trader of consumer goods. Later, the Company decided to get involved in the business of construction and civil works. With the change in the business activity, the Company name was changed to "Anubhav Infrastructure Private Limited" on August 13, 2007.
